1. Service Description
Celvo provides automated subscription recovery and customer communication services to SaaS businesses ("Merchants") via Stripe Connect integration. Our service includes:
- Detection of failed payments through Stripe webhook monitoring
- Decline-code-aware smart retry logic to recover soft declines before dunning
- Pre-dunning outreach for expiring cards and payments requiring customer action
- Multi-step branded dunning email sequences sent to your customers on your behalf
- AI-powered classification of customer email replies (8 intent categories)
- Automated action routing: AP forwarding, sequence pausing, escalation
- Branded card update pages for customer self-service payment updates
- Dashboard with recovery analytics, attribution trail, and case management
The service is provided "as is" and "as available." We do not guarantee specific recovery rates or outcomes.

5. Pricing and Billing
Celvo uses performance-based pricing. You only pay when we recover revenue:
- Single plan: 10% of recovered revenue during the 30-day trial period, 13.5% thereafter. Everything included. No monthly fees.
There are no monthly subscription fees. Recovery fees are calculated on the gross amount recovered and billed monthly via Stripe. A recovery is attributed to Celvo when our AI-driven actions (reply classification, AP routing, sequence management) directly contribute to payment success.
Each recovery includes a full attribution trail visible in your dashboard, so you can verify exactly what was recovered and why a fee was charged.
6. 30-Day Trial
New merchants receive a 30-day trial at 10% of recovered revenue, which includes a recovery audit of your Stripe payment history. During the trial, the full recovery system is active. After the trial, standard performance-based pricing (13.5%) applies. You are only charged when we successfully recover revenue.
No credit card is required to start the trial or run the recovery audit.
